Can a beginner use Unreal Engine?

Can a beginner use Unreal Engine?

Unreal Engine is one of the most powerful and popular game development engines on the market. With its vast range of features, tools, and capabilities, it’s often considered intimidating for beginners. However, with the right guidance, a beginner can definitely start using Unreal Engine and start creating amazing projects.

Why Unreal Engine is not just for experienced developers

Unreal Engine is widely used in the game industry, and it’s home to many popular titles like Fortnite, Mass Effect, and The Witcher 3. Despite its powerful features, it’s still accessible to beginners. Unreal Engine offers a range of tools and features that are designed to help new developers get started and learn quickly.

Easy to start with Unreal Engine

If you’re new to Unreal Engine, don’t be discouraged by the vastness of its feature set. Unreal Engine provides a well-structured editor that helps you navigate its features, making it easier to find what you need. The engine comes with plenty of tutorials, documentation, and resources to help you get started.

Blueprints and Visual Scripting

Unreal Engine’s Blueprints system allows you to create game logic without writing a single line of code. With Blueprints, you can create complex logic flows without needing programming experience. This makes it an ideal tool for beginners who are new to coding.

What skills do you need for Unreal Engine?

While Unreal Engine is relatively easy to start with, it still requires some technical skills to master. Here are some key skills that can help you get the most out of Unreal Engine:

  • Familiarity with the Unreal Editor: This is where you create and edit your game project.
  • Understanding of game development concepts: You need to understand how games are structured, and how physics, animation, and game logic work together.
  • Basic programming knowledge: Even with Blueprints, you’ll still need to write some code, especially when working with advanced features or custom plugins.
  • Troubleshooting and debugging skills: Unreal Engine can be complex, and you’ll need to know how to troubleshoot and debug issues.

Python support in Unreal Engine

Unreal Engine also supports Python, which can be used to create custom plugins, scripting, and more. If you’re already familiar with Python, this can be a great way to dive deeper into the engine’s capabilities.

Can anyone sell games made with Unreal Engine?

Yes! Unreal Engine allows you to sell your games on popular platforms like Steam, Xbox, PlayStation, and the Epic Games Store. With Unreal Engine’s royalty policy, you can earn money from your games without sharing your profits.

Limitations of Unreal Engine

While Unreal Engine is powerful, it’s not the best choice for every type of project. Here are some limitations to consider:

  • Memory usage: Unreal Engine is a heavy engine, and it requires a significant amount of RAM to run smoothly.
  • Complexity: Unreal Engine has a lot of features, which can be overwhelming for beginners.
  • Cost: Unreal Engine’s royalty policy may apply, which means you’ll have to share some of your profits with the engine developers.

Conclusion

Unreal Engine is an incredibly powerful game development engine that’s accessible to beginners. With its intuitive interface, extensive documentation, and Blueprints system, you can create amazing projects without needing to write complex code. By understanding the basic skills required to use Unreal Engine, and being aware of its limitations, you can start your game development journey today!

Your friends have asked us these questions - Check out the answers!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top